Fruit World Famous is a series of fruit sours. Always made from the finest fruit purée. This rendition is packed with the brightest raspberries we could find. Enthusiastically crafted at our church brewery in Sundbyberg, Stockholm, Sweden.

Pours a vibrant red with fine pink head.
Smell is sweet and tart with huge notes of raspberries backed by some lime, raspberry jam and vanilla.
Taste is tart with a huge hit of raspberries. Behind is a nice sweetness and also a sliight bitterness. Notes of pie crust, lime and some vanilla. Highly refreshing.
Mouthfeel is medium, creamy and well carbonated.
Overall, a terrific sour where the raspberries really are the star of the show.

Sculpted from the ripest of raspberries, Omnipollo launches a brand spankin' new series of sour ale, starting off with raspberries.
The inaugural edition of Fruit World Famous pours ruddy ruby and wit a turbidly dense appearance. As any froth quickly rises and then falls, a condensed dark berry fruitiness comes with a host of dark fruit, vinous fruit, cider and citrus. A mild cakey sweetness is suggestive of red velvet cake with cereal, honey and light cream.
The raspberries kick into high gear once the creamy ale hits the middle palate. Bursting with condensed raspberry intensity, the ale is nearly plum-like with hints of black cherry, currant, blueberry and blackberry. All wrapped in a creaminess of wafer, vanilla and cereal, the richness is broken up by the bracing tartness of crabapple, sour grape, lime, lemon and gooseberry on the way to a tantalizingly warheads finish.
Medium bodied and staring sweeter, the ale makes tremendous headway toward a pleasantly sour finish assisted with dryness, crispness and refreshment despite such pastry insinuations.
